I would leave the power supply as is, because you may cause unexpected problems
when changing parts. It is a carefully tuned feedback amplifier.
Having worked on older ARC designs I will second that comment. In addition there is nothing to be gained changing semi-conductors in these units... except trouble.
The type will be printed on the transistors case.
ARC often uses house numbers which are hard to cross to generic commercial types because they don't provide that information.
ARC often uses house numbers which are hard to cross to generic commercial types
because they don't provide that information.
I think some of these devices are selected/screened for the application.
